Apparatus for controlling an air inlet valve for a solid fuel burner

1. An apparatus for controlling flow of air through an air inlet in a solid fuel burner, the apparatus comprising:
a. a mechanical temperature sensor for sensing temperature within the solid fuel burner, the sensor comprising first and second elongate parts, the first elongate part having a first end that moves linearly in a direction of a length of the first elongate part, due to a difference in thermal expansion coefficients of the materials of the first and second elongate parts, in response to a change in the sensed temperature, wherein the first elongate part has a high coefficient of thermal expansion relative to the second elongate part; and
b. a movable valve member for controlling the flow of air through the air inlet, the moveable valve member being coupled to the first end of the first elongate part so as to close or restrict the air inlet as the sensed temperature increases.
